Here is the patch notes:

Champ Spawns

* Non-Felucca facets Champ Spawns will now give special rewards for working the spawns
* Killing the Champ Spawn boss on any facet has a 30% chance of dropping a special reward
* Working the Ilshenar spawns gives Transcendence scrolls but not 105 powerscrolls
* A black gate will no longer appear after killing the Champ Spawn boss unless you are in Felucca
* Rewards have a durability of 150/150 and cannot be enhanced or unraveled
* Each Champ Boss has a chance to drop a Unique, Decorative, or Shared reward drop - such as Animated Water Tiles with Rock
* Shared rewards do not mean every boss has them, but only that more than 1 boss may drop it (usually 3 bosses).
* Drop rate of rewards set to an overall 30% chance, as follows:
o 5% Unique reward
o 15% Decorative reward
o 10% Shared reward
* Two types of rewards can be obtained while leveling the spawn: Scrolls of Transcendence (SoT) and 105 Powerscrolls (PS).

From FoF: June 12th

Does the chance of a Rares/Deco/Replica drop at the Valor/Spirituality/Humility/Tokono Champ Spawn increase based on how much of the spawn you kill & if so,does it only apply to one spawn session or does your chance reset each time you log out or start a different champ spawn? Is killing the early spawns cumulative until I get an artie?
The person who worked most of the spawn (earned the most points based on number and difficulty of the creatures killed) has the highest chance of receiving a replica. If that person doesn’t win it, then all the people who earned enough points to qualify for the replica have an equal chance at it, including the person who worked it the most. The points reset each time you start a different champ spawn. Logging out doesn’t reset your points. Only defeating the boss does. Points are altar specific so earning points at Altar A doesn’t count towards earning a replica at Altar B.
-Sakkarah

Fighting just the boss will typically NOT earn you enough points to qualify for the replica, according to posts by the devs... This was done to stop the Ilshenar and other Trammel-ruleset equivalents of "raids" from occurring, where 4 or 5 people would work up Serado or Oaks, then 20 people show up just for the boss fight to try to get the rare.

Players A & B work up a spawn until the champion spawns. Both players then proceed to switch characters to C & D. Even though the points accumulated with A & B don't reset because they are logged out the system still rules them out from getting a replica as they aren't present at the champ.

Thus, there is a 30% chance a replica will drop and C & D have equal chances of winning it as there is no top spawn killer who is eligible to receive a replica.

If A stays and B switches his character he will still be able to receive a replica as long as he gets loot rights on the champion. His chances of receiving a replica will be lower than A's since A is the top spawn killer at that time.
